Heim  >  Artikel  >  Java  >  Java verwendet die Funktion max() der Math-Klasse, um die größere von zwei Zahlen zu erhalten

Java verwendet die Funktion max() der Math-Klasse, um die größere von zwei Zahlen zu erhalten

WBOY
WBOYOriginal
2023-07-24 23:17:052708Durchsuche

Java verwendet die Funktion max() der Math-Klasse, um den größeren Wert zweier Zahlen zu erhalten.

Bei der Java-Programmierung müssen wir häufig die Größen zweier Zahlen vergleichen und dann die größere Zahl auswählen, um einige Operationen auszuführen. Die Math-Klasse in Java bietet viele Funktionen für mathematische Operationen, darunter die Funktion max(), die uns dabei helfen kann, den größeren Wert zweier Zahlen zu ermitteln. Die Funktion

Math.max() ist wie folgt definiert:

public static int max(int ​​​​a, int b)

Diese Funktion akzeptiert zwei ganzzahlige Parameter a und b und gibt die größere der beiden Zahlen zurück. Wenn a und b gleich sind, wird entweder a oder b zurückgegeben. Das Folgende ist ein Beispielcode, der die Funktion Math.max() verwendet, um die größere von zwei Zahlen zu erhalten:

public class MaxExample {
   public static void main(String[] args) {
      int number1 = 20;
      int number2 = 30;

      int maxNumber = Math.max(number1, number2);

      System.out.println("较大值为:" + maxNumber);
   }
}

Im obigen Beispiel haben wir zwei Ganzzahlvariablen Nummer1 und Nummer2 definiert und ihnen 20 bzw. 30 zugewiesen. Anschließend verwenden wir die Funktion Math.max(), um die größere der beiden Zahlen zu ermitteln und weisen das Ergebnis der Variablen maxNumber zu. Schließlich verwenden wir die Funktion System.out.println(), um den größeren Wert an die Konsole auszugeben.

Wenn wir den obigen Code ausführen, erhalten wir die folgende Ausgabe:

Der Maximalwert beträgt: 30

Die Funktion Math.max() funktioniert auch mit Gleitkommazahlen. Das Folgende ist ein Beispielcode, der die Funktion Math.max() verwendet, um den größeren Wert von zwei Gleitkommazahlen zu erhalten:

public class MaxExample {
   public static void main(String[] args) {
      double number1 = 20.5;
      double number2 = 30.7;

      double maxNumber = Math.max(number1, number2);

      System.out.println("较大值为:" + maxNumber);
   }
}

In diesem Beispiel definieren wir zwei Gleitkommazahlenvariablen Nummer1 und Nummer2 und weisen die Werte zu ​​auf 20,5 bzw. 30,7. Anschließend verwenden wir die Funktion Math.max(), um die größere der beiden Gleitkommazahlen zu ermitteln und weisen das Ergebnis der Variablen maxNumber zu. Schließlich verwenden wir die Funktion System.out.println(), um den größeren Wert an die Konsole auszugeben.

Wenn wir den obigen Code ausführen, erhalten wir die folgende Ausgabe:

Der größte Wert ist: 30,7

Zusammenfassend stellt die Math-Klasse von Java die Funktion max() bereit, um den größeren Wert zweier Zahlen zu erhalten. Diese Funktion kann mit Ganzzahlen und Gleitkommazahlen verwendet werden. Mit dieser Funktion können wir die Größe zweier Zahlen bequemer vergleichen und die größere Zahl für nachfolgende Operationen auswählen.

Das obige ist der detaillierte Inhalt vonJava verwendet die Funktion max() der Math-Klasse, um die größere von zwei Zahlen zu erhalten.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n